Abstract
The goal of remediating polluted soil is to ensure safe reuse of the polluted soil by reducing the concentrations of pollutants in soil to the environmental standard limits. However, there is currently lack of evaluation on techniques and their performance of soil remediation,which has limited applications of the soil remediation in China. In this paper, we proposed technique selection standards and efficiency eval-uation criteria of soil remediation, based on the related regulations of soil pollution control, the ecological risks of pollutants, and the current situation of soil pollution, and then examined the performance of proposed soil remediation techniques in laboratory and in-situ polluted field in Tongguan. The results showed that both soil remediation techniques and their performance evaluation criteria were practicable. This re-search could provide some valuable information for restoration of polluted sites, remediation of polluted farmland soils and protection of agri-cultural product safety.
